  7. Fajita -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Fajita

    The term originally referred to skirt steak, the cut of beef first used in the dish. [3] Popular alternatives to skirt steak include chicken and other cuts of beef, as well as vegetables instead of meat. [4] [5] In restaurants, the meat is usually cooked with onions and bell peppers.

  9. Machaca -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Machaca

    Prepared machaca can be served any number of ways, such as tightly rolled flautas, tacos, or burritos, [10] or on a plate with eggs, onions and peppers (chiles verdes or chiles poblanos). Machaca is almost always served with flour tortillas that tend to be large, up to 20 inches in diameter. [ 11 ]
